The main geographic nexus for the Cybercrime Programme in 2024 are Central America, Eastern Africa, MENA and South East Asia & … WebJan 16, 2024 · Wire fraud is a criminal act of fraud or an attempt to commit fraud with the aid of some form of electronic communication – such as a telephone or computer – and/or communication facility. It is the means of communication used in a fraud scheme that distinguishes wire fraud from mail fraud.
A curb stomp, also called curbing, curb checking, curb painting, or making someone bite the curb, is a form of assault in which a victim's mouth is forcefully placed on a curb and then stomped from behind, causing severe injuries and sometimes death.
